I have CFS,also scored 0 at medical, and have just won appeal (only to WRAG, but very grateful for that). The descriptors you will get points for is very individual. At my tribunal, I found there was little or no time for me to 'argue' my case, but the doctor had obviously looked at my ESA50 and picked out descpriptors she thought I could score on and thoroughly questioned myself and my dad on them. Also, none of the evidence I had sent in after the initial decision was taken into consideration- it was made clear they could only purely go by the descriptors and if I fulfilled them, adn to do this used the ESA50 and medical report.
So my advice is know the strongest descriptors you fulfill points for and why, and make a note of them in case you forget and hopefully you will be fine, as it sounds as if you should fulfill enough points as I did.
